# Proselint-9 Environments

Proselint-9 is the docs linter behind the Fennwick publishing stack. Three environments: dev, stage, prod. Support should only touch stage. Dev resets hourly; prod changes require a change ticket. Rule packs differ per environment — stage runs the strict pack, prod runs relaxed. If a customer reports a false positive, reproduce on stage first. Stage runs with these configuration values:

config for yajep-tafof:
[rusath]
team = julmir
access_code = ac_fe37fd
host = rusath.novactech.test
port = 8000
owner = pelmir.weneth
peer = oliwyn.olvarqdyn.internal

Q: Where's the evacuation-chair store, and can I get into it? A: It's the grey cupboard by the Stair 2 landing on each floor of Brindle Wharf. Facilities folk can open it any time — it's not just for drills, but please log anything you take out. The cupboard keypad was reset last month, so the current code is below.

turnstile pass: bdg-JVSWH-52711

Runbook: Sporewatch, our typo-squatting package scanner. If you get paged, it usually means the nightly registry diff choked, not that we're under attack. First, check that the mirror sync finished; a partial sync makes everything look like a new suspicious package. Re-run the scan with the --resume flag and clear the quarantine queue of obvious false positives. When the rerun goes green, grab its trace token, which is printed right below this paragraph.

pipeline stamp: htk31_f769b577b3028a4e9958e5bb8d1259a